Kingswood restaurant highlighted in TV exposé on food industry

fsaA popular Kingswood restaurant has been highlighted in a BBC documentary for its zero hygiene rating.

Inside Out West revealed that 66 premises in the west of England – including 11 in Bath & North East Somerset, six in Bristol and two in South Gloucestershire – have been given a zero rating for their hygiene.

Zero means urgent improvement is necessary. Among them is the Rupali Tandoori in Two Mile Hill, which the programme makers revealed was nonetheless displaying a five-star rating in its window.

Councils work with the Food Standards Agency (FSA) to score premises between zero and five. Each hygiene rating is available to view online at http://ratings.food.gov.uk/ but businesses are not forced to display their rating on their premises.

The Rupali, which got the zero rating in July, is rated as four or five-star by many reviewers on the TripAdvisor website.
